1994 Peugeot 306 vs. 2005 Peugeot 307

To start off, 2005 Peugeot 307 is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Peugeot 306.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Peugeot 306 would be higher. At 1,905 cc (4 cylinders), 1994 Peugeot 306 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1994 Peugeot 306 (92 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 3 more horse power than 2005 Peugeot 307. (89 HP @ 5250 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1994 Peugeot 306 should accelerate faster than 2005 Peugeot 307.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Peugeot 307 weights approximately 210 kg more than 1994 Peugeot 306.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1994 Peugeot 306 (200 Nm @ 2250 RPM) has 67 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Peugeot 307. (133 Nm @ 3250 RPM). This means 1994 Peugeot 306 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Peugeot 307.
